Job DescriptionIntroductionThe J.P. Morgan Financial Institutions Trade Sales team is a dynamic client-focused department that prioritizes growth and serving large, high-demand clients. We provide some of the world’s oldest financial products such as Documentary Letters of Credit, Draft Discounting, and Trade Loans, while also offering custom solutions through innovative digital methods to address our clients’ liquidity, risk mitigation, and working capital needs.Job SummaryAs Financial Institutions Trade Sales Associate In Global Trade Services the role offers the opportunity for the candidate to enhance their core Trade skills and sales abilities while also acquiring valuable experience about the Global Trade finance. The associate will be required to work closely with Trade risk, Credit, assets distribution desk along with Financial Institution group team. This role is based in Dubai – United Arab Emirates (UAE)Job ResponsibilitiesCapable of effectively managing diverse stakeholders across various Trade Sales work streams.Contribute to the development of the Trade strategy for the Central Easter Europe, Middle East and Africa (CEEMEA) region, which includes market analysis and competitors, in alignment with the global Trade Finance strategy. Identify and suggest new opportunities for extending Trade products, to support sales processes and client coverage in collaboration with the FIG team. Coordinate with the distribution team on the adequate sell down strategy for a particular transaction based on the wider T&WC strategy.Work closely with the Core Trade Product team on new products approvals in jurisdictions where opportunities have been identified. Develop, analyse, and provide support for trade MIS functions in the CEEMEA region, with a focus on volume, revenue, and rebates for specific product segments. Prepare updates on sales activities for internal and external client use along with credit committees writeups.Operate as part of a regional team with minimal supervision and be responsible for transaction pricing strategies, in addition to Credit lines management. Required Qualifications, Capabilities And SkillsA detailed understanding of the Core trade products & able to demonstrate the relevant level of industry experienceRelevant Trade experience in Central Eastern Europe, Middle East and Africa and understand the market dynamics across the region. Credit Course Certificate from an international institution is a plus. Proficient analytical, Sales and presentation skills, as well as project management and strategic planning abilities. Interpersonal skills are essential for maintaining close working partnerships with Product, Customer Service, and Product Delivery managers to guarantee satisfactory customer experiences and profitable products.
